A member asked:

I went to the restroom,was concerned some tp got left behind in my vaginal area. i checked using my hands and air got in. any risk of air embolism?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Not a chance: Air entering the vagina in the manner you describe cannot pass through the cervix. Even if air got in this way, it would enter the abdominal cavity and not blood vessels. You have nothing to worry a bout.
